U.S. and Norway establish first fully integrated joint logistics command for NATO Exercise Cold Response 26
The new headquarters represents the first fully integrated joint logistics command between the Norwegian Armed Forces and the U.S. Marine Corps. It was activated in mid-January to support the live phase of Exercise Cold Response 26. U.S. Marine Corps Brigadier General Maura Hennigan, Commanding General of 2nd Marine Logistics Group, will assume command of the Combined Joint Logistics Support Group on 27 February 2026.
